I think they may be a variant of Ergalatax margariticola, but they
appeared substantially different from the very typical specimens of
margariticola I found at the same locality. They have only 6 varices,
and the inner lip and columella coloration is different from the
others. I considered the form crassulnata; but I didn't know whether it
occurred in Thailand. Are these 2 actually a different species?
